Summary
The purpose of this clinical trial is to learn about the pharmacokinetics and safety of a drug called zavegepant from samples collected using a patient-centric device called Tasso-Plus (for liquid blood sample collection) and Tasso-M20 (for dried blood sample collection) compared to standard venous sample collection. This study consists of two periods and will enroll approximately 14 healthy participants. In period 1, half of the enrolled participants (n=7) will use Tasso-Plus, and the other 50% (n=7) will use Tasso-M20. For each participant, PK samples will be collected after zavegepant administration in period 1 using the assigned Tasso device simultaneously with collecting venous blood samples. In addition, taste assessments will be performed at time intervals of 1 (immediately after dosing), 5, 10 and 20 minutes after zavegepant IN administration. Also, if feasible, 4 Japanese participants will be enrolled among those 14 participants to evaluate the PK and safety of zavegepant IN in Japanese vs. non Japanese participants. In period 2, a butterscotch candy will be given 5 minutes before administering the zavegepant IN study intervention. Taste assessment will also be performed after zavegepant IN administration with a butterscotch candy in period 2. For taste assessment, each participant will record the sensory attributes at timed intervals of 1 (immediately after dosing), 5, 10 and 20 minutes after zavegepant administration in each period. The expected duration of participation from screening until follow-up telephone contact is approximately 9 weeks.
